 | Journalist: Liverpool decision on Federico Chiesa could hinge on what happens with ex-Everton flop |

Atalanta are poised to sign Liverpool forward Federico Chiesa as a replacement for Ademola Lookman, who has submitted a transfer request to leave the Italian club. Lookman’s desire to move on comes after three successful years in Bergamo, where he helped Atalanta achieve notable success including winning the Europa League. The club has set a high price of around €50 million for Lookman, with Inter Milan showing keen interest and having offered €40 million so far, though the bid has been rejected. Lookman is reported to have agreed terms with Inter and is even willing to lower his wage demands to facilitate the transfer.
Meanwhile, Chiesa, who has not been included in Liverpool’s squad for their pre-season tour of East Asia, appears likely to join Atalanta once Lookman departs. Atalanta see the 27-year-old Italian winger as a suitable replacement given his performance in his debut Liverpool season, where he scored twice and provided two assists in 14 appearances. Reports indicate that Atalanta and Liverpool are negotiating with Liverpool potentially covering part of Chiesa's salary to facilitate the move.
Lookman publicly expressed his mixed emotions about leaving Atalanta in a heartfelt statement, appreciating his time at the club and highlighting his ambition to reach the World Cup after having won the European Championship. The transfer saga continues as Atalanta await a sufficiently strong offer to sanction Lookman’s exit, which would unlock their ability to sign Chiesa and reshape their attacking options for the upcoming season.
